Subject: [PATCH] Fix double free in compute_abbrevs
PR32934 reports an abort in obstack_free after a double free.
The relevant code is in compute_abbrevs:
...
t = (struct abbrev_tag *)
obstack_alloc (&ob2,
sizeof (*t)
+ (max_nattr + 4) * sizeof (struct abbrev_attr)
+ (max_nattr + 4) * sizeof (int64_t));
...
obstack_free (&ob2, (void *) t);
cuarr = (dw_cu_ref *) obstack_alloc (&ob2, ncus * sizeof (dw_cu_ref));
...
obstack_free (&ob2, (void *) t);
...
The following happens:
- t is allocated
- t is freed
- cuarr is allocated
- t is freed.
Usually, cuarr == t, so effectively cuarr is freed.
But in the case of the PR, cuarr != t, so t is freed twice, triggering the
abort.
Fix this by freeing cuarr instead.
Tested on x86_64-linux.
